Sažetak
Differential cross sections for the scattering of Na(3S) and Na(3P) from H2O have been measured in a crossed-beam experiment. The total differential cross sections measured at collision energies between 0.2 and 1.3 eV show double-rainbow structures. They are attributed to two different geometries of the sodium-water collision complex. A simple evaluation yields the pairs of (relative) minima of 28±4 and 233±32 meV for the Na(3S)-H2O and 30±4, 499±17 and 271±5, 759±22 meV for the Na(3P)-H2O interaction. The reactive cross sections are found to be less than 10% of the non- reactive ones even under the most favourable conditions, namely Na(3P) colliding with H2O at 1.3 eV.
